You spend your life defending liberty,
You uphold reason, truth, prosperity;
Yet no-one notices your fervent prose.
And tyranny’s not lessened. No, it grows!

The climate’s changing, though. And, meme by meme,
People are learning things ain’t what they seem.
Slowly are rising tides of rage and hate
Against the privileges of the state.

A house without foundations cannot stand;
The state’s philosophy is built on sand.
All politics today is forged from nix
But violence, theft, fraud, lies and dirty tricks.

The work is long and wearying, my friend;
Sometimes, you think the pain will never end.
But darkest is the hour before the dawn,
Till vanquished by the splendour of the morn.

The Justice Clock inexorably ticks
Towards the Final Fail of politics.
Meanwhile I wish you, with much Christmas cheer,
A happy, prosperous, free, just New Year.
